Installation: - For macOS and Windows [macOS/Windows](https://github.com/cli/cli/blob/trunk/README.md) - For linux Installation on specific distribution [linux](https://github.com/cli/cli/blob/trunk/docs/install_linux.md) ### Authentication Authenticate with your Github account. ```bash gh auth login ``` ### Pull Request Create a pull request. ```bash gh pr create -t -b <body> ``` Check out pull requests locally. ```bash gh pr checkout ``` Check the status of yout pull requests. ```bash gh pr status ``` View Your pull requests' checks. ```bash gh pr check ``` ### Issues View and filter a repository's open issues. ```bash gh issue list ``` ### Release Create a new release. ```bash gh release create 0.1 ``` ### Repo View repository READMEs. ```bash gh repo view ``` ### Create Shortcut Create Shortcut for a gh command. ```bash gh alias set bugs 'issue list --label="bugs"' ```
